Batch Index du Forum
S’enregistrerRechercherFAQMembresGroupesConnexion
Répondre au sujet Page 1 sur 1
[R] Comment faire cette boucle ?
Auteur Message
Répondre en citant
Message [R] Comment faire cette boucle ? 
Salut tout le monde Smile
Je souhaite faire cette commande dans une boucle for...loop
J'ai par exemples 10 fichiers nommés comme suit 1.reg - 2.reg - 3.reg - 4.reg ......- 10.reg
Donc le nombre maximale je le connais est 10.
Ma question comment je peux faire cette commande dans une boucle for :
Code:
Copy 1.reg+2.reg+3.reg+4.reg+5.reg+6.reg+7.reg+8.reg+9.reg+10.reg All.reg




Dernière édition par Hackoo le Dim 6 Nov 2016 - 21:28; édité 1 fois

______________________________________________________
Mes Contributions en Téléchargement
Message Publicité 
PublicitéSupprimer les publicités ?


Répondre en citant
Message Re: Comment faire cette boucle ? 
Hackoo a écrit:
Salut tout le monde Smile
Je souhaite faire cette commande dans une boucle for...loop
J'ai par exemples 10 fichiers nommés comme suit 1.reg - 2.reg - 3.reg - 4.reg ......- 10.reg
Donc le nombre maximale je le connais est 10.
Ma question comment je peux faire cette commande dans une boucle for :
Code:
Copy 1.reg+2.reg+3.reg+4.reg+5.reg+6.reg+7.reg+8.reg+9.reg+10.reg All.reg

Comme ça :
Code:
@Echo off
(for /l %%A in (1 1 10) do (type %%A.reg))>All.reg


Ma solution à l'avantage d’omettre la présence de 0x1A à la fin du fichier (semble être un bug de copy).




______________________________________________________
Partager permet le savoir. Le savoir permet de partager de nouveau savoirs.
Répondre en citant
Message Re: Comment faire cette boucle ? 
TSnake41 a écrit:
Hackoo a écrit:
Salut tout le monde Smile
Je souhaite faire cette commande dans une boucle for...loop
J'ai par exemples 10 fichiers nommés comme suit 1.reg - 2.reg - 3.reg - 4.reg ......- 10.reg
Donc le nombre maximale je le connais est 10.
Ma question comment je peux faire cette commande dans une boucle for :
Code:
Copy 1.reg+2.reg+3.reg+4.reg+5.reg+6.reg+7.reg+8.reg+9.reg+10.reg All.reg

Comme ça :
Code:
@Echo off
(for /l %%A in (1 1 10) do (type %%A.reg))>All.reg


Ma solution à l'avantage d’omettre la présence de 0x1A à la fin du fichier (semble être un bug de copy).

Ton idée me convient beaucoup et mon problème est résolu Wink
Merci Laughing Okay




______________________________________________________
Mes Contributions en Téléchargement
Message [R] Comment faire cette boucle ? 


Montrer les messages depuis:
Répondre au sujet Page 1 sur 1
  



Index | créer un forum | Forum gratuit d’entraide | Annuaire des forums gratuits | Signaler une violation | Conditions générales d'utilisation
Copyright 2008 - 2016 // Batch